This is how it will be in the midst of the land among the people—like an olive tree after it's been shaken, or like the few grapes left behind after the harvest.
When thus it shall be in the midst of the land among the people, there shall be as the shaking of an olive tree, and as the gleaning grapes when the vintage is done.
Verse Analysis
Plain-English insight for readers
In Isaiah 24:13, the imagery of an olive tree being shaken and the remnants of grapes after harvest illustrates the desolation that will occur among the people. Just as an olive tree loses most of its fruit when shaken, so too will the population experience loss and devastation. The few remaining olives and grapes symbolize the remnants of hope and survival amidst widespread destruction. This verse serves as a reminder of the consequences of turning away from God and the judgment that follows. It highlights the fragility of life and the reality that even in times of great loss, there may still be a small remnant that endures. This remnant can represent those who remain faithful to God, even in difficult circumstances, suggesting that hope can persist even in dire situations.

What does Isaiah 24:13 mean?
Isaiah 24:13 uses the imagery of a shaken olive tree and leftover grapes to illustrate the devastation among the people. It signifies loss and desolation, while the few remaining fruits symbolize hope and survival amidst destruction.
What is the significance of the olive tree in Isaiah 24:13?
The olive tree in Isaiah 24:13 represents the loss experienced by the people, as it loses most of its fruit when shaken. This imagery highlights the fragility of life and the consequences of turning away from God.
What does the remnant in Isaiah 24:13 represent?
The remnant in Isaiah 24:13 symbolizes those who remain faithful to God despite widespread destruction. It suggests that even in dire circumstances, there is hope and survival for those who endure.
How does Isaiah 24:13 relate to themes of judgment?
Isaiah 24:13 reflects themes of judgment by illustrating the consequences of the people's actions. The desolation depicted serves as a warning about the results of turning away from God.
